London : Tate Gallery Pub, 1984. First Edition. Softcover. Near fine paperback copy. Slightest suggestion only of dust dulling to the spine bands and panel edges. Remains uncommonly well-preserved; tight, bright, clean and sharp-cornered. Previous owner's bookplate. Physical description; 248 pages : illustrations (some colour), portraits ; 34 cm. Subjects; Stubbs, George 1724-1806. Tate Gallery (London, England) Exhibitions. Yale Center for British Art (New Haven, Conn.) Exhibitions.
